Hiring a senior Flutter developer in Mumbai enables organizations to tap into a pool of mobile app experts skilled in building high-performance, cross-platform applications. Mumbai offers access to top professionals with experience across fintech, e-commerce, and SaaS sectors. The city’s thriving tech ecosystem, competitive costs, and strong educational infrastructure make it an ideal location to find skilled Flutter developers who understand both local and global market trends.
Why Choose Mumbai for Senior Flutter Developers
Mumbai stands as one of India’s most dynamic tech hubs, hosting startups, established IT firms, and innovation centers. The city produces well-trained developers through institutions like the Indian Institute of Technology Bombay (IIT Bombay), Sardar Patel Institute of Technology, and K. J. Somaiya College of Engineering. Frequent tech meetups and events such as Droidcon India and Flutter Mumbai Meetups help developers stay updated. Hiring in Mumbai also provides cost advantages compared to Western markets, along with professionals fluent in English and familiar with international work cultures.
Key Skills to Look For
Technical expertise
Senior Flutter developers should master Dart programming, state management tools like Provider or Bloc, and integration with RESTful APIs. Proficiency in Firebase, Git, and CI/CD pipelines is essential for scalable project delivery.
Portfolio depth
Look for a portfolio demonstrating complex, real-world applications across sectors like fintech, retail, or logistics, reflecting both design finesse and backend integration strength.
Soft skills
Strong communication, team leadership, adaptability, and ownership are crucial, especially when managing remote or hybrid teams.
Industry experience
Experience with Mumbai’s leading industries, including financial services, media, and e-commerce, ensures contextual knowledge that enhances project outcomes.
Screening & Interviewing Process
Portfolio evaluation
Assess the quality, performance, and user experience of past Flutter apps. Check for contributions to open-source projects or app store presence.
Interview formats
Combine technical interviews with live coding or problem-solving sessions. Conduct both video and in-person discussions to gauge communication and collaboration skills.
Sample interview questions for Senior Flutter Developer
- How do you manage app state efficiently in Flutter?
- Can you explain your approach to performance optimization?
- Describe a challenging Flutter project and how you resolved technical issues.
- How do you handle version control and CI/CD workflows?
Technical verification
Include a paid trial project or coding test to validate hands-on skill and adherence to best practices.
Reference checks
Contact previous clients or employers, ideally from Mumbai or similar markets, to confirm reliability and delivery quality.
Factors for Successful Collaboration
Clear briefs and milestones
Define project goals, deliverables, and deadlines precisely to avoid confusion and maintain accountability.
Collaboration tools
Use Trello or Asana for task management, Google Drive for file sharing, and Slack for communication. These tools promote transparency and efficiency.
Feedback and revision process
Set up regular review cycles to incorporate feedback and align outcomes with expectations.
Contract essentials
Include scope, deliverables, timelines, payment terms, and confidentiality clauses in formal contracts.
Regular progress check-ins
Schedule weekly updates or sprint reviews to maintain alignment and trust throughout the development cycle.
Challenges to Watch Out For
Scope creep
Control changes through documented approvals and clear change management policies.
Intellectual property protection
Ensure IP transfer agreements and licensing terms are documented before project initiation.
Payment security
Use escrow services or formal invoicing to safeguard both client and developer interests.
Communication delays
Plan meetings considering time zones and ensure consistent communication through agreed channels.
Actionable Next Steps
Sign Up
Create an account on Qureos by entering your details on the sign-up page. Provide your email and create a secure password.
Enter Your Search Criteria
After logging in, specify key requirements such as experience with Flutter, Dart, Firebase, and project scale.
Browse Candidates
Review profiles of senior Flutter developers in Mumbai that match your criteria and assess portfolios carefully.
Screen Candidates
Shortlist candidates, conduct interviews, and evaluate technical and communication skills.
Reach Out to Shortlisted Candidates
Contact top matches directly through Qureos for streamlined communication and hiring.
Start hiring top senior Flutter developers in Mumbai, India today!
FAQ
What skills should a senior Flutter developer in Mumbai have?
They should master Dart programming, Flutter architecture, RESTful API integration, Firebase, and state management. Leadership and communication skills are equally important.
How much does it cost to hire a senior Flutter developer in Mumbai?
Rates vary by experience but generally range from INR 1,500 to INR 3,000 per hour or competitive monthly packages depending on project scope.
Where can I find experienced Flutter developers in Mumbai?
You can use platforms like Qureos to connect with vetted Flutter professionals experienced in delivering enterprise-grade mobile apps.
What industries in Mumbai commonly hire Flutter developers?
Top industries include fintech, edtech, logistics, media, and e-commerce, where cross-platform app performance is key.
Why hire locally in Mumbai instead of remote developers abroad?
Local hiring offers easier collaboration, cultural alignment, and faster response times while maintaining global project standards.
Conclusion
Hiring a senior Flutter developer in Mumbai provides access to experienced professionals skilled in advanced mobile app development. With Mumbai’s strong talent base, cost advantages, and vibrant tech community, your next project can achieve outstanding results. Sign up on Qureos today to find the perfect developer for your needs.







